The word ‘homeostasis’ is derived from two Greek words: ὅμοιος (homoios), which means ‘similar’ and στάσις (stasis), which translates to ‘standing still’. Homeostasis thus refers to the tendency of a system to maintain a stable, relatively constant internal environment, regardless of the outside changing conditions.
